#content table.wgBlaetterer td {
   padding-left: 5px;
}

#content table.wgBlaetterer td span {
   font-weight: bold;
}

#content table#listeMasterTable td.kursvw_td {
   cursor: pointer;
}
#content table#listeMasterTable td{
   padding: 4px !important;
   border: 1px #CCC solid;
}

#content #listeMasterTable th {
   background-color: #DADCE4;
   color: #0F2063;
   padding: 4px;
   text-align: left;
   border-left: 1px solid #DADCE4;
   border-right: 1px solid #DADCE4;
   font-weight: bold;
}

.ungerade {
   background-color: #EFEFEF;
}
.gerade {
   background-color: #FFF;
}

#content .neuerKurs{position: relative;}
#content .neuerKurs img{
   position: absolute;
   top: -2px;
   left: -23px;
}


#content .kursBegonnen,
#content .kursBegonnen a, 
#content .kursBegonnen a:link,
#content .kursBegonnen a:visited {
   color: #656565;
}

#content table#listeMasterTable td.kursvw_td_nummer{width: 10%;}
#content table#listeMasterTable td.kursvw_td_titel{width: 50%;}
#content table#listeMasterTable td.kursvw_td_termine{width: 10%;}
#content table#listeMasterTable td.kursvw_td_datum{width: 30%;}
